Gunakan access logs Global Accelerator (GA) untuk menganalisis perilaku pengguna, mengidentifikasi pola lalu lintas geografis, dan memecahkan masalah. GA terintegrasi dengan Simple Log Service (SLS) untuk mengumpulkan dan mengirimkan access logs untuk kelompok titik akhir.
Pengenalan Access Logs
Anda dapat mengaktifkan logging akses untuk satu atau beberapa kelompok titik akhir dari instans GA. Log dikirimkan ke Logstore SLS di wilayah yang sama dengan kelompok titik akhir tersebut. Setiap entri log mencakup bidang seperti alamat IP sumber klien, port sumber klien, alamat IP tujuan, port tujuan, dan Wilayah akselerasi. Untuk detail bidang, lihat Referensi bidang log.
Kasus penggunaan
Memecahkan Masalah
Gunakan access logs untuk cepat menemukan dan menyelesaikan masalah.
Sebagai contoh, Anda dapat memeriksa status pesan acknowledgement Global Accelerator menggunakan bidang status untuk memecahkan masalah mengapa permintaan akses tidak menerima respons yang diharapkan.
Perencanaan Bisnis
Analisis access logs untuk mendukung perencanaan bisnis dan penskalaan resource.
Sebagai contoh, Anda dapat menggunakan Tren Lalu Lintas di area percepatan untuk melakukan upgrade bandwidth lebih awal guna mendukung pertumbuhan bisnis atau menurunkan spesifikasi bandwidth untuk mengurangi biaya. Anda juga dapat menggunakan bidang http_host dalam access logs untuk melihat daftar host yang mengakses aplikasi Anda selama periode waktu tertentu, sebagai persiapan pembaruan aplikasi.
Penagihan
Fitur access log GA gratis. Anda hanya membayar penggunaan SLS. Untuk informasi lebih lanjut, lihat Penagihan Simple Log Service.
Batasan
Logging akses hanya tersedia di wilayah yang mendukung SLS. Untuk informasi lebih lanjut, lihat Wilayah yang didukung.
Hanya instans GA standar yang mendukung access logs. Instans GA dasar tidak mendukungnya. Semua prosedur dalam topik ini berlaku untuk instans GA standar.
Anda tidak dapat mengumpulkan access logs untuk kelompok titik akhir yang ditempatkan pada node titik kehadiran (PoP) Alibaba Cloud.
Anda tidak dapat melakukan kueri nama domain titik akhir.
Jika Anda tidak dapat menggunakan fitur access log, versi instans Anda mungkin tidak mendukungnya. Untuk menggunakan fitur ini, hubungi manajer bisnis Anda untuk melakukan upgrade instans.
Membuat access log
Sebelum memulai, pastikan listener dan kelompok titik akhir telah ditambahkan ke instans GA Anda. Untuk informasi lebih lanjut, lihat Menambahkan dan mengelola listener perutean pintar.
Login ke Global Accelerator console.
Pada halaman Instances, klik ID instans GA.
Pada halaman detail instans, klik tab Access Log.
Pada tab Access Log, klik Create Access Log. Pada kotak dialog Storage Configuration, konfigurasikan parameter berikut lalu klik OK.

Konfigurasi
Deskripsi
Select Storage Content
Listener ID/Name
Pilih listener yang sudah ada.
Endpoint Group ID/Name
Pilih kelompok titik akhir tujuan.
Storage Settings
Region
Secara default, wilayah tempat kelompok titik akhir berada dipilih.
Project
Unit manajemen resource di SLS yang digunakan untuk isolasi dan kontrol resource.
Klik Select Project untuk memilih project yang sudah ada, atau klik Create Project untuk membuat yang baru.
Logstore
Unit di SLS untuk mengumpulkan, menyimpan, dan melakukan kueri data log.
Klik Select Logstore untuk memilih Logstore yang sudah ada, atau klik Create Logstore untuk membuat yang baru.
Custom Headers
Enable Custom Headers
Jika diaktifkan, GA mencatat Header HTTP yang ditentukan dalam bidang
ga_headerspada access logs.CatatanFitur header kustom sedang diluncurkan secara bertahap. Hubungi manajer akun Anda untuk mengaktifkannya.
Ukuran maksimum default untuk header kustom adalah 1 KB. Anda dapat meningkatkannya hingga 4 KB. Hubungi manajer akun Anda untuk meminta perubahan ini.
Setelah Anda mengaktifkan fitur ini, volume data log Anda mungkin meningkat, yang dapat mengakibatkan biaya tambahan untuk Simple Log Service (SLS). Untuk informasi lebih lanjut, lihat Penagihan Simple Log Service.
header name
Masukkan nama Header HTTP yang akan dicatat. Pisahkan beberapa nama dengan tanda titik koma (;). Jika dibiarkan kosong, semua header akan dicatat.
CatatanSaat Anda melakukan operasi ini, sistem memeriksa apakah peran terkait layanan AliyunServiceRoleForGaFlowlog sudah ada untuk GA.
Jika peran tersebut belum ada, sistem akan membuatnya secara otomatis dan menyambungkan kebijakan AliyunServiceRolePolicyForGaFlowlog. Ini memberikan izin kepada GA untuk mengakses SLS dan mengirimkan flow logs ke SLS.
Jika peran tersebut sudah ada, sistem tidak membuat ulang.
Untuk informasi lebih lanjut, lihat AliyunServiceRoleForGaFlowlog.
Setelah pembuatan selesai, lihat access log pada tab Access Log.

Aksi lainnya
Operasi | Deskripsi |
View an access log |
|
Edit Custom Header | Pada tab Access Log, temukan access log lalu klik Edit Custom Header di kolom Actions. Setelah memperbarui konfigurasi, klik OK. |
Delete an access log |
|
Setelah SLS mengumpulkan access log, Anda dapat mengunduh, mengirimkan, memproses, dan mengatur notifikasi berdasarkan data log tersebut. Untuk informasi lebih lanjut, lihat Operasi umum pada log layanan Alibaba Cloud.
Contoh penggunaan
Menampilkan access logs mentah
Pada tab Raw Logs di halaman Logstore, Anda dapat melihat entri log mentah.
Sebagai contoh, Anda dapat mengklik bidang client_ip untuk melihat informasi alamat IP klien. 
Menanyakan access logs tertentu
Pada halaman Logstore, Anda dapat memasukkan pernyataan SQL di kotak pencarian Search & Analyze untuk menanyakan access logs tertentu.
Sebagai contoh, ikuti langkah-langkah berikut untuk menanyakan distribusi geografis alamat IP klien. 
Nomor urut | Deskripsi |
1 | Masukkan pernyataan SQL berikut untuk menghasilkan peta panas alamat IP klien dan melihat 10 wilayah teratas tempat klien berada. Hal ini membantu dalam perencanaan kapasitas. |
2 | Pilih rentang waktu lalu klik Search & Analyze. |
3 | Pada tab Graph > Properties, klik ikon |
Referensi bidang log
Bidang-bidang berikut tersedia dalam access logs di SLS.
Bidang | Deskripsi |
accelerator_region | Wilayah akselerasi. |
client_ip | Alamat IP klien (alamat IP sumber). |
client_port | Port klien (port sumber). |
egress_bytes | Merujuk pada traffic yang dikembalikan selama periode sampling. |
endpoint_group_id | ID kelompok titik akhir. |
endpoint_group_region | Wilayah tempat kelompok titik akhir ditempatkan. |
endpoint_ip | Alamat IP titik akhir (alamat IP tujuan). |
endpoint_port | Port titik akhir (port tujuan). |
ga_id | ID instans GA. |
ingress_bytes | Lalu lintas masuk selama periode sampling. |
listener_id | ID listener. |
protocol | Protokol transmisi jaringan yang digunakan oleh listener. |
status | Status paket respons yang dikirimkan oleh GA. |
time | Waktu saat entri log dibuat. |
upstream_connect_time | Durasi koneksi. |
upstream_first_byte_time | Waktu hingga byte pertama. |
Bidang-bidang berikut hanya tersedia untuk listener HTTP dan HTTPS.
Bidang | Deskripsi |
http_host | Header Host dari permintaan. |
http_referer | Header HTTP Referer dari permintaan yang diterima oleh GA. |
request_method | Metode permintaan. |
request_uri | URI permintaan yang diterima oleh GA. |
ga_headers | Konten header kustom. Saat fitur header kustom diaktifkan, GA mencatat Header HTTP yang ditentukan dalam bidang ini. |